Embodiment 1
[0033] Embodiment 1: The main process parameters of 16 stages of electric bicycle storage battery internalization are as follows:
[0034] Phase Charging Method Current Time
[0035] 1 reverse charge 0.9A 20 minutes,
[0036]2 Charge 1.3A for 1 hour,
[0037] 3 Charge 3.5A for 5 hours,
[0038] 4 Charging 2.6A 8 hours,
[0039] 5 Charging 1.1A for 3 hours,
[0040] 6 discharge -2.4A 2.5 hours,
[0041] 7 Charging 3.5 A 3.5 hours,
[0042] 8 Charge 2.4 A for 4 hours,
[0043] 9 Discharge -3.6 A for 1 hour,
[0044] 10 charging 3.4 A 4 hours,
[0045] 11 Charge 2.4 A for 4 hours,
[0046] 12 Charge 1.0 A for 1 hour,
[0047] 13 discharge -4A for 2 hours,
[0048] 14 Charge 2.6 A for 4 hours,
[0049] 15 Charge 1.3 A for 4 hours,
[0050] 16 Charging 4 A 0.5 hours.
